CEDAR CITY, Utah (AP) — A 43-year-old man was killed when his pickup truck rolled over on Interstate 15 near Toquerville. Police say his teenage son had been driving.
The Spectrum of St. George reports (http://bit.ly/1KOjgZt ) that Utah Highway Patrol identified the man killed Friday afternoon as Joseph Ryan Henrie.
UHP says the driver drifted off the road and overcorrected before the vehicle rolled at least two times.
The release says both people were wearing seatbelts and that the father was pronounced dead at the scene. The driver was taken by ambulance to Dixie Regional Medical Center.
The extent of the driver's injuries was not immediately available.
UHP is investigating whether fatigued driving is to blame for the accident.
